TPO ro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a roof covered with thermoplastic polyolefin (TPO) membrane, which is commonly used in commercial and some residential roofing systems.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as tears, punctures, or blistering, as well as checking the integrity of seams and flashing. Service providers may also evaluate the condition of any penetrations, such as vents or skylights, to ensure they are properly sealed and functioning. Regular inspections can help identify potential issues early, before they develop into costly repairs or roof failures.

One of the primary benefits of a TPO roof inspection is identifying problems that can compromise the roof’s waterproofing capabilities.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ause the membrane to degrade, leading to leaks or water infiltration. Inspections can reveal areas where the membrane has become brittle or cracked, as well as issues with loose or damaged seams. Detecting these problems early allows property owners to plan maintenance or repairs proactively,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ent more extensive damage to the underlying structure.

TPO roof inspections are suitable for a variety of property types, including commercial buildings, warehouses, industrial facilities, and resid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s. These inspections are particularly valuable for properties that experience heavy weather exposure or have experienced recent storms, as these conditions can accelerate membrane deterioration. Property owners who notice signs of roof damage, such as water stains inside the building, mold growth, or visible cracks on the roof surface, should consider scheduling an inspection to determine the condition of the membrane and address any issues promptly.

What is involved in a TPO roof inspection? A TPO roof inspection typically includes checking for membrane damage, seam integrity, ponding water, and overall roof condition to identify potential issues before they worsen.

Why should I schedule regular TPO roof inspections? Regular inspections help detect early signs of wear, tears, or leaks, which can prevent costly repairs and extend the lifespan of the roofing system.

How do local contractors assess TPO roof conditions? Local service providers evaluate the roof's surface, seams, flashing, and drainage to determine if repairs or maintenance are needed based on the roof’s current state.

What signs indicate I might need a TPO roof inspection? Visible issues such as bubbling, cracking, pooling water, or roof membrane discoloration can signal the need for an inspection by a qualified professional.

Can a TPO roof inspection help prevent leaks? Yes, inspections can identify vulnerable areas or damage that might lead to leaks, allowing repairs to be made before water intrusion occurs.
